Vigo unfolds along the water, and a bicycle is the easiest way to stitch it together in a single afternoon. Ride the Paseo Marítimo out from the port and you will pass fishing boats, oyster stalls near the old town, and open views of the ría before the road flattens into the long promenade at Praia de Samil, with the Cíes Islands sitting on the horizon like a postcard you get to keep pedalling toward.

Central Vigo climbs steeply from the harbour, which is exactly why a bike here works so well: the coastal stretch from the port through the old town to Samil is flat, well paved, and mostly separated from traffic, so you cover kilometres of shoreline that would wear you out on foot. Once you're warmed up, the same route stretches further west toward Canido and even O Vao, distances that buses and taxis don't really serve.

Top 10 things to see in Vigo by bike

  1. Praia de Samil — Vigo's flagship city beach with a long flat promenade, easy riding along the ría with views toward the Cíes Islands.
  2. Paseo Marítimo de Vigo — the waterfront path linking the port to Samil, the natural spine of any ride in the city.
  3. Casco Vello (Vigo Old Town) — a compact historic centre of steep lanes, oyster stalls and Praza da Constitución, worth locking up the bike and walking.
  4. Monte do Castro — a hilltop fortress park with the best panoramic viewpoint over the harbour and ría.
  5. Parque de Castrelos — Vigo's largest park, home to the Pazo Quiñones de León and shaded paths for an easy ride.
  6. Praia de Canido — a quieter, more local beach just west of Samil along the same coastal road.
  7. O Vao Beach (A Ramallosa) — a flatter ride further out past Samil toward Baiona, popular for its long sandy stretch.
  8. Monte da Guía / Panorámica da Guía viewpoint — a rewarding uphill ride to a lookout over the estuary near the Virgen de la Roca statue.
  9. Vigo Port and Puerto Deportivo (marina) — where ferries leave for the Cíes Islands, a natural start or finish point for a harbourside ride.
  10. Baiona seafront and old town — a longer coastal ride south along the ría to a picturesque fishing town with its own castle and marina.

What do you need to rent a bike in Vigo?

None. Spain requires no licence for a bicycle at any age, so all you need is a valid ID and, in most cases, a card to cover the deposit. Rental firms usually set their own minimum age, often around 16 or 18, and the deposit is normally blocked on a credit card in the renter's name rather than charged outright.

How much does it cost to rent a bike in Vigo?

Expect roughly 3–5 EUR per day in low season and 8–15 EUR per day in high season, with electric or premium models running 12–20 EUR per day at the summer peak.

  • Cheapest from November to February, when the ría can be windy but the promenade is still perfectly rideable.
  • Prices climb from spring onward and peak in July and August, alongside demand for Samil and the coastal routes.

When to book a rental bike in Vigo?

July and August are Vigo's high season, when Samil fills up and beach-route bikes get booked out early, so reserve a few days ahead if you're travelling then. From November to March, low season keeps prices at their lowest and the promenade quiet, while May–June and September–October offer the best balance of mild weather, thinner crowds and reasonable rates.

Local traffic rules in Vigo

Spain drives on the right. Cyclists must wear a helmet on interurban roads regardless of age, and only riders under 16 need one within the city itself, though wearing one anyway is good sense on Vigo's hillier streets. Speed limits run from 50 km/h in built-up areas down to 30 km/h on single-lane urban roads, so bikes share calm, slow-moving traffic on most of the coastal route. Riding after drinking follows the same 0.5 g/l blood alcohol limit as driving, and vehicles overtaking a cyclist must leave at least 1.5 m of clearance — a rule that makes the promenade and quieter lanes feel genuinely safe to explore.

Which insurance is provided with my rental bicycle?

Bicycle rentals typically come with basic cover for third-party damage, but theft and damage terms vary from one provider to another. Some include simple loss or damage protection in the price, while others cover it through your deposit; always check the exact terms on the booking page before you confirm.
